From Borders to Powerlines

For Uttam Shinde, RoW Officer, the journey from guarding borders to powering them has been nothing short of transformative.

Born in a village in Kolhapur where electricity was scarce, his childhood was lit by the dim glow of a kerosene lamp. Today, he strengthens the very transmission backbone that once felt like a distant privilege. Life has come full circle.

His story began in 2001 with the Border Security Force. For over two decades, Uttam served across high‑altitude terrains, anti‑naxal operations, artillery command, and VVIP security. The uniform instilled discipline, resilience, and accountability - qualities that became his compass for leadership. Alongside service, he pursued education, believing knowledge sharpens command.

Service builds character, discipline builds leaders, and purpose builds nations.

In 2021, after voluntary retirement, he sought a new mission. Corporate roles added perspective, but he longed for an organisation where values matched purpose. He found that alignment at Resonia.

Joining as a RoW Executive, Uttam discovered that nation‑building does not end at the border. It continues through infrastructure that powers homes, industries, and hospitals. Transmission networks are silent guardians of progress, and being part of that mission carries the same responsibility he once felt in uniform.
